Keegan Brown organises NHS fundraising raffle

Keegan Brown is currently running a fundraiser to say thank you to the NHS staff working in the ICU/Isolation Ward in the hospital during the Coronavirus pandemic.

Brown can see this at first hand in his job as a laboratory assistant for the NHS. In this capacity, he examines for example, blood and urine samples to identify health problems.

“Still overwhelmed”

At first it was Brown's intention to only auction a limited shirt of his own which pays tribute to the NHS, but slowly there was support from fellow darts players.

“Originally with my limited edition shirt I was hoping to raise £500, I’m pretty sure that has been blown out the water,” said Brown to Dartsnews.

“I am still overwhelmed at how many people have responded with generous offers. The prizes are incredible and it just shows how thankful people are for the NHS and the care it gives.”
